Booom.ai (Playroom): Multiplayer Backend for Web Games
Booom.ai's Playroom lets developers add real-time multiplayer to web and mobile games in minutes—no server setup required.
Overview
Booom.ai is home to Playroom, a serverless multiplayer backend built for game developers who want to skip the headache of infrastructure management. Instead of spinning up servers, configuring networking, or writing backend logic, developers can drop in a lightweight SDK and immediately sync game state across every connected player and screen. Playroom works across popular engines and frameworks like Three.js, Unity, Godot, React Three Fiber, and PlayCanvas, making it flexible enough to slot into almost any existing web-based game project.
At its core, Playroom offers a simple API for setting and getting room state, with automatic synchronization handled behind the scenes using a hybrid WebRTC/WebSocket approach that keeps latency under 50ms. This makes it well-suited for a huge range of game types—IO games, casual titles, turn-based experiences, async games, live-streamed sessions, and true real-time multiplayer. Whether you're building a small indie project or a social game meant to bring hundreds of players together in shared avatar-driven worlds, Playroom removes the backend bottleneck so teams can focus on gameplay instead of plumbing.
The platform scales automatically as your player base grows, with tiered pricing based on monthly active users (MAU) rather than complex infrastructure billing. This makes it approachable for solo developers experimenting for free, while still offering the scalability and support enterprise studios need for large, global multiplayer titles.

Core Features
- Scalable multiplayer backend with automatic global scaling
- Zero server setup or backend code required
- Simple API for reading and writing room/player state
- Automatic real-time state synchronization across players and screens
- Low-latency networking via automatic WebRTC/WebSocket switching
- Broad engine support including Three.js, Unity, Godot, React Three Fiber, and PlayCanvas

Pros
- •Eliminates the need to build or manage backend infrastructure
- •Works across multiple popular game engines and frameworks
- •Automatic low-latency networking simplifies real-time gameplay
- •Free non-commercial tier makes it easy to prototype and test
- •Pricing scales predictably with MAU rather than server complexity
Cons
- •Reliance on a third-party backend introduces platform dependency risk
- •MAU-based pricing could get costly for games with large, non-monetized user bases
- •Custom or highly specialized multiplayer logic may require workarounds within the provided API
- •Enterprise-level features like dedicated support require custom pricing negotiations
How to Use
1. Install the Playroom SDK via npm (playroomkit). 2. Import the necessary modules into your game project. 3. Use the provided hooks and API calls to set or get the state of a game room. 4. Player and screen states sync automatically across all connected clients in real time. 5. Test locally, then deploy—no server configuration or backend code required.

Pricing
Playroom offers a free non-commercial Hobby tier, with paid plans starting at $10/month for 15,000 MAU, scaling up to $150/month for 200,000 MAU, and custom Enterprise pricing for 1M+ MAU with dedicated support.
